An ocotillo in a planter.

Post by helen gaus »

Image A plant well suited to the desert. In the heat of day the leaves fold close to the branches to conserve water and lower the plant's temperature. During the evening or during wetter days the leaves spread open. I added the red-orange flowers. They are lovely in the late spring. In fact the whole Sonoran Desert is bursting with color in the spring.
